Lewismrl  [author] 5 Jun, 2020 @ 9:59am 
These are all new physics and far closer to represent current NGTC specifications. The old cars had too much downforce, these mirror reality far closer, and they can be harder to drive on opening laps so need a lap or two before you can push, please bear this in mind. As for hopping around on the straight, not something we've experienced so unsure what this is. Check or tune your setup and FFB settings would be my suggestion
